Yeah. Essentially 6 46 watts do = 12 23 watts. The advantage of the 12 23 watt set up is you can place the lights in numerous areas to get light to hard to reach spots for your plants (particularly during flowering).

23w bulbs are 1700 lumens and the 46w bulbs are 2700 lumens.

You don't get 2:1 in wattage, but you also can't just stack lumens up linearly, 2x1700 lumen bulbs is not 3400 lumens for the entire grow space.

I personally feel that it would be better to go with the 150w equivs and just get less of the higher wattage bulbs, more intense light = more penetration to lower branches.
